PADDING
Protects boney prominences preventing excoriation, cushions and supports the wound. |

| OrthoBand: |
Synthetic padding on a roll providing even consistency and thickness giving a more even surface overall. Protection reduces moisture absorption reducing the risk of pressure sores. |

CONFORMING BANDAGE
This can be a knitted, woven or lightweight cohesive bandage such as Co-Form. This layer will hold padding in place and assist with protection, support, immobilisation and compression bandages. These bandages have the ability to conform easily allowing essential movement. There are many different weights and materials available depending on the reason required. |

| Knit-Fix: |
Medium weight knitted bandage providing a non-slip and warmth properties. |
| Knit-Firm: |
Dense knitted bandage providing a non-slip and warmth properties. |
| Millcrepe: |
Dense cotton crepe bandage has the advantage of being washable. |
| Vet-Band: |
Very fine woven bandage. |
| W.O.W: |
Strong non-stretch woven bandage, (does not conform well to body parts) |
| Co-Form: |
Lightweight, strong cohesive bandage with non-slip properties. |
| Co-Lastic: |
Lightweight, strong cohesive muslin gauze bandage with non-slip properties. |
